Upper Cutter is so awesome. Gives Kirby a KO move, a much better recovery, a combo ender, a good "Shoryuken"-ish/OoS move (I remember reading it has a couple invincibility frames at the beginning)...I really wish it was his default up special. I will say that patience and power shielding will be your friend against any character with projectiles.

I've played a few Yoshi's here and they've all typically switched to the Egg throwing game, which is smart. You started there, so that was definitely good.

I would say maybe try to be a little less aggressive and wait for spacing opportunities. Yoshi's eggs are great because they allow you to dodge out of the way of MB/CB while at the same time tossing a projectile. And even if you aren't in the line of fire, you're able to curve the eggs around my projectiles to get them in. It can be a pretty frustrating game to play that will force me to approach you instead of the opposite.
